Try Alternate Way to Clear Recently Deleted Album · ...Tap a photo or video, then do either of the following: Delete: Tap to delete a photo from your iPhone and other devices using the same iCloud Photos account. Deleted photos and videos are kept in the Recently Deleted album for 30 days, where you can recover or permanently remove them from all devices. This folder could keep …Jul 2, 2023 · Jul 2, 2023 8:16 AM in response to DavidNikoloff. iCloud Photos is a syncing service. Any photo you delete from a device where iCloud Photos is turned on will also be deleted from iCloud and from any other device connected to iCloud Photos. You can potentially reduce the storage space required on a device by turning on Optimize Storage. Utilizing iCloud Backup.
